
Kedronova Leads Red Raider Invitational After 36 Holes
9/24/2024 10:32:00 PM | Women's Golf
LUBBOCK, Texas – The Kent State women's golf team began their second tournament of the season on Tuesday with the first two rounds of the Red Raider Invitational contested at The Rawls Course. As a team, the Golden Flashes sit in fifth place out of the field of 16 teams at 3-over-par after recording a 2-over-par 290 in round one and a 1-over-par 289 in round two.
The story of the day for Kent State was the play of Veronika Kedronova. After leading the Flashes at the season-opening Boilermaker Classic three weeks ago, the reigning MAC freshman of the year continued her strong start to the season on Tuesday. Kedronova is tied for the lead among the field of 87 golfers after firing a 2-under-par 70 in round one and a 3-under-par 69 in round two to accumulate a total score of 5-under-par heading into Wednesday's final round.
Another Flash who has flourished early in the season is Gracie Larsen. The freshman from Australia fired back-to-back rounds of even-par 72 on Tuesday to conclude round two inside the top 20, tied for 17th place. After finishing inside the top ten to open her collegiate career at the Boilermaker Classic, Larsen will look to challenge the top of the leaderboard in Wednesday's third round.
Another freshman who put up a consistent performance on Tuesday was Isabella Goyette. The Medina, Ohio native recorded back-to-back rounds of 1-over-par 73 in just her second collegiate tournament to end the day at 2-over-par and tied for 23rd place after 36 holes.Â
In round one, the Flashes' final countable score toward the team total came from Leon Takagi, with a 3-over-par 75. The reigning MAC golfer of the year is tied for 48th at 8-over-par after shooting a 5-over-par 77 in round two. The final countable score toward the team total in round two was recorded by Aryn Matthews. The freshman recovered from an 8-over-par 80 in round one with a 3-over-par 75 in round two. Matthews is tied for 67th place entering tomorrow's third round.
The Flashes will conclude the Red Raider Invitational on Wednesday, with round three's shotgun start set for 10 a.m. EST.
